Kleiner Prinz Sword Plant (Echinodorus ‘Kleiner Prinz’) — Live Aquarium Plant
A compact “rose sword” that stays small, colorful, and beginner-friendly.
Kleiner Prinz (German for “Little Prince”) is a dwarf Echinodorus cultivar known for its tight rosette shape and warm bronze-to-reddish new growth under good light. It’s an awesome midground plant for nano-to-medium planted tanks, and it can also be used as a small centerpiece in shallow aquascapes.

Size & Placement
-
Placement: Midground / Small centerpiece
-
Expected height: ~4–8 in (10–20 cm)
-
Growth rate: Moderate
-
Form: Rosette (leaves grow from the base)
Care Requirements
-
Light: Low to Medium (color improves with Medium–High)
-
CO₂: Not required (recommended for faster growth + better color)
-
Fertilizer: Strongly recommended
-
Root tabs = best results (sword plants are heavy root feeders)
-
Liquid ferts help too, especially in newer setups
-
-
Substrate: Nutrient-rich aquasoil preferred, but will grow in inert substrate with root tabs
-
Temperature: 72–82°F
-
pH: ~6.0–7.5 (very adaptable)
Tips for Best Color
-
Use medium+ lighting
-
Add consistent nutrients (root tabs every 4–8 weeks)
-
Keep iron and macros steady (avoid “on/off” dosing)
-
CO₂ is optional, but it helps the plant look denser and cleaner
